Tipping Point Commission 2012- 2013
Tipping Point is a commissioned collaboration running for one year between an artist and a scientist. It’s focus is an interdisciplinary collaboration exploring ideas and possible research through art at the frontiers of science.
As a scientist interested in space and weather and as an artist who identifies herself psycho-pathologically with the sun, Dipankar Banerjee and Neha Choksi embark on a year-long collaboration of solar study and visual creation. The work will combine inspiration from the history of the science of solar weather, solar imaging techniques and our changing understanding of visuality. The perception of the sun as a unique element of the landscape which perpetually recurs as if in rehearsal for the final fatal sunset will manifest as theatrical expression in the joint work.
